Basic S ystem Properties in Digital Signal Processing
1. Linearity
A system is linear if it satisfies the principles of superposition and homogeneity . F or inputs x
1
[n]
andx
2
[n] , and scalarsa andb , a linear systemT produces:
T{ax
1
[n]+bx
2
[n]} =aT{x
1
[n]}+bT{x
2
[n]}
This implies the system’ s response to a weighted sum of inputs is the same weighted sum of
individual responses.
2. Time-Invariance
A system is time-invariant if a time shift in the input results in an identical time shift in the
output. F or an inputx[n] and outputy[n] =T{x[n]} , if the input is shifted b yn
0
, the output is:
T{x[n-n
0
]} =y[n-n
0
]
This property ensures the system’ s behavior does not change over time.
3. Causality
A system is causal if the output at an y time n depends only on the current and past inputs
(x[n],x[n-1],... ). F or a system to be causal:
y[n] =T{x[m],m=n}
Non-causal systems depend on future inputs, which is impr actical for real-time processing.
4. Stability
A system is stable (in the bounded-input, bounded-output sense) if every bounded input pro-
duces a bounded output. If|x[n]|=M
x
<8 for alln , then for a stable system:
|y[n]|=M
y
<8
This ensures the system does not produce unbounded outputs for finite inputs.
5. Memory
A system has memory if its output depends on past or future inputs in addition to the current
input. A memoryless system’ s output depends only on the current input:
y[n] =T{x[n]}
S ystems with memory , such as filters, use past inputs to compute the output.
